But an electrician could make the connections protected by adding a brief section of copper wire to the tip of every aluminum wire. That way, copper somewhat than aluminum will be linked to each swap, outlet or other system. COPALUM connectors are most well-liked by the CPSC, but they require a skilled contractor and a particular device. AlumiConn is another brand that can be purchased from online suppliers. These connectors could be put in by any skilled electrician however could require that present junction boxes be replaced with bigger ones to make room for the connectors. Electricity is transmitted from the utility generating stations to particular person meters utilizing almost exclusively aluminum wiring. In the U.S., utilities have used aluminum wire for over 100 years. Between the early Nineteen Sixties and the Seventies, more than two million homes throughout the United States were outfitted with aluminum wiring. By the 1970s, it turned obvious that there have been some critical hazards to aluminum wiring. Rewiring and upgrading is normally required by Insurance Companies. They have data on the hazards of aluminum wiring, and base their choices on this knowledge.

A shortage of copper caused prices to skyrocket proper when our nation’s constructing increase began. Copper prices remained excessive till the mid-1970s, so builders outfitted greater than two million houses in the United States with cheaper aluminum wiring. Sometimes aluminum rewiring is replaced by tearing out walls. After the rewiring is full, you have to install new drywall. Replacing aluminum wiring can price greater than $10,000 to replace.

Although aluminum wiring restore just isn't as comprehensive as a full wiring replace, it is significantly cheaper and may be enough to make the house protected and to satisfy purchaser issues. Where COPALUM isn’t obtainable, the CPSC does accept another pigtailing methodology utilizing a set screw connector known as AlumiConn as the following greatest different. Whichever methodology is out there in your locale, the CPSC extremely recommends having a licensed electrician carry out this work. Exposed wires in the attic or the basement can lend a clue as as to whether there is aluminum wiring in the home. Many of the plastic “jackets” over these wires might be labeled with letters corresponding to ALUM or ALUMINUM. Aluminum wiring is most probably to be present in properties built between the mid-1960s and the mid-1970s.

The resulting oxidization causes the connection point to get even hotter. Over time, the connection can turn out to be unfastened, creating arcing which in turn may lead to a fireplace hazard. Reported problems with aluminum wiring have been associated to the overheating and failure of aluminum wiring terminations. This is because of the tendency of aluminum wiring to oxidize, and aluminum’s incompatibility with gadgets designed to be used with copper wiring solely. Aluminum has the next rate of enlargement than copper wiring, which might lead to unfastened connections, arcing and melting, eventually fireplace. Warm cover plates or discolouration of switches or receptacles, flickering lights or the odor of scorching plastic insulation may be evidence of poor or improperly made connections.

Loose connections improve electrical resistance, which can soften fixtures and insulation. Approved copper-to-aluminum connections plus antioxidant compounds must be used.
